DEVOPSdigest is hosting its first annual list of DevOps Predictions. DevOps experts — analysts and consultants, and the top vendors — offer thoughtful, insightful, often controversial and sometimes contradictory predictions on how DevOps and related technologies will evolve and impact business in 2016 ...
DevOps
Attempting to weigh the current level of DevOps maturity within your organization is one of those daunting propositions that can leave today's business and technology pros searching for meaningful answers. There are some well-established metrics that can serve as inherent measurements of overall DevOps success, including deployment frequency rates, average lead times, meant time to recovery (MTTR), and of course, any figures resulting from dedicated Application Performance Monitoring (APM). Yet, perhaps even more valuable than some of these numbers, or of greater import to practitioners for purposes of self-assessment, are metrics that help analyze precisely how ongoing DevOps adoption compares to similar efforts among peers ...
As a result of virtualization and the shift to software-defined networking (SDN), a DevOps culture has begun to emerge in the telecom industry that requires network operators to look beyond technology and the network, and embrace a holistic view of product development, business development, operations and planning ...
I love the Bourne movies. Apart from the action, what I find fascinating is the uncanny abilities of the protagonist – Jason Bourne; his sixth-sense. He can quickly "weigh up" his surroundings and make detailed assessments of all dangers. This acute level of awareness gives him a distinct competitive advantage. We need this ability in IT Operations, especially with performance monitoring – we need Jason Bourne's situational awareness ...
DevOps is an organizational and cultural rethink of how software-driven organizations can become organizations at velocity – agile enough to innovate and fast enough to deal with any change that comes their way ...
DEVOPSdigest asked experts from across the industry to define what DevOps means to them. The goal is to show just how many varied ideas are connected with the concept of DevOps, and in the process learn a little more what DevOps is all about. The fourth and final installment outlines the many approaches and tools associated with DevOps ...
DEVOPSdigest asked experts from across the industry to define what DevOps means to them. The goal is to show just how many varied ideas are connected with the concept of DevOps, and in the process learn a little more what DevOps is all about. The third installment shows the impact of DevOps on both Dev and Ops team members ...
DEVOPSdigest asked experts from across the industry to define what DevOps means to them. The goal is to show just how many varied ideas are connected with the concept of DevOps, and in the process learn a little more what DevOps is all about. The first installment covers how Dev and Ops work together ...
What is DevOps? It is one of the hottest buzzwords in IT, but many have difficulty finding a specific definition. The truth is that DevOps means different things to different people. DEVOPSdigest asked experts from across the industry to define what DevOps means to them. The purpose of this list is not to come up with a one-sentence definition of DevOps to appeal to all. The goal is to show just how many varied ideas are connected with the concept of DevOps, and in the process learn a little more what DevOps is all about.
The list of 17 Ways to Define DevOps will be posted in four parts over the next four days. The first installment provides the high level view ...
Improving end-user customer experience is one of the key objectives of an application performance management solution in a production environment. By leveraging the application performance data earlier in the development cycle, DevOps teams can ensure readiness for exceptional customer experience before deploying any application in production. Finally, harnessing the business data in application transactions and logs and correlating them with operational data can provide actionable business insights. In this blog, I will discuss five steps to DevOps success leveraging an application performance management solution in production ...
The perception that adopting DevOps is all about culture, not as much about technology, would appear rather shortsighted. No question, navigating the involved people and process issues is widely recognized as the biggest challenge in adopting DevOps models. That's an established concept that I doubt anyone familiar with this movement would attempt to dismiss. However, it's also very clear that finding the right tools and services to support this evolution is a hugely critical piece of the puzzle ...
Times are changing. With the imperative to deliver applications faster, developers are increasingly stepping outside their traditional skill-zones and leveraging new automated capabilities – allowing them to develop and test in parallel, while releasing software continuously. In essence, they're not only writing great music, but also building the instruments upon which to play it ...
EMA’s survey team is in the final stages of launching my latest research, “Automating for Digital Transformation: Tools-Driven DevOps and Continuous Software Delivery” ...
Most discussions of DevOps assume that the "dev" is being done exclusively in programming languages of recent vintage and that the "ops" are occurring exclusively on distributed or cloud platforms. There are, however, at least three compelling reasons to have a DevOps discussion that focuses on the mainframe ...
Choosing the right DevOps tools for your business can be a complex and confusing process. There are literally dozens of technology providers out there, from large enterprise companies to smaller, new companies vying for your attention ...
The move to DevOps also introduces additional constraints to our burgeoning Iron Polygon, as individual projects become less distinct. In an environment focused on continuous automated testing as well as continuous integration and deployment, individual iterations become the project unit as organizations establish regular cadences of repeated iterations instead of the discrete, monolithic project releases that characterize traditional waterfall-oriented development ...
What it means to build quality software has taken a beating over the years. We're no longer content to strive for defect-free code. We must also make sure the software meets both its functional and nonfunctional requirements. Only now with the rise of more Agile ways of thinking, we've placed the notion of a software requirement under the microscope, as building flexible, resilient software often trumps checking items off our requirements list. As a result, the tried and true Project Management Iron Triangle has taken its lumps. We've been trying to bend or rework the Iron Triangle for years, with limited success. Today, thanks to DevOps and Agile Architecture, we finally can ...
As the pace of business and technology innovation accelerates, IT organizations are under pressure to deliver software faster and at higher levels of quality. Automation is a key enabler for this process. We are conducting a new Enterprise Management Associates (EMA) study to uncover the key process and automation-driven competencies contributing to accelerated software delivery. A secondary goal is to uncover the relationships, if any, between these competencies and revenue growth ...
A new global survey reveals the top traits of companies who are disrupting their competitors and transforming into successful software-driven, digital businesses. Here's what you can learn from them ...
The software-defined data center (SDDC) is crucial to the long-term evolution of an agile digital business according to Gartner, Inc. It is not, however, the right choice for all IT organizations currently ...
To better understand why everyone — including IT Operations — needs to care about DevOps, CA Technologies interviewed four DevOps luminaries and thought leaders. Their deep insights make a compelling case for Agile Operations and provide immediate practical guidance on how to get started. Here are some excerpts from the interviews ...
APMdigest, the world's online forum for Application Performance Management and related technologies, has launched a new partner site, DEVOPSdigest. The new website will focus on technologies and processes related to DevOps, agile development, continuous delivery (CD), testing and more ...
As enterprises embrace the DevOps philosophy, and the coalescence of the Development and Operations continues, I foresee the conditions ripening to foster innovative methods of making application performance better and code deployments smoother. To me, the argument that system monitoring is just a “nice to have” and not really a core requirement for operational readiness dissipates quickly when a critical application goes down with no warning ...
Testing has often been the low priority on the totem pole in the world of software development. That's not because it isn't important and there isn't value placed on it, but rather because it is difficult, the tools and platforms available are time-consuming to implement and it is the area that most often gets the compressed end of the schedule. Talk to large enterprises and see how many of them have outsourced much of their QA to the lowest cost offshore firm they can find ...